SeaView Community Services - Recovery Housing Program is a 90 to 180-day treatment program for adults in Seward, AK. Our approach combines attachment focused therapeutic work and the principles and concepts of recovery with experiential therapies. The individuals admitted to the Recovery Housing Program receive the latest in substance use disorder treatment and therapy for co-occurring disorders.

The SeaView Community Services Recovery Housing Program can provide living space for up to 10 individuals who will reside in SeaView’s bay view apartments located in downtown Seward, Alaska. Residents live in shared apartments while participating in a program of therapeutic activities, supportive relationships, and psychiatric treatment. Clinicians and Clinical Associates spend time in residents’ homes each day to gain insight that enhances treatment and recovery.

Residents are initially engaged in daily clinical programming for a minimum of 4 hours per day, Monday through Friday, at the SeaView Plaza under the direction of the Clinical Program Manager. As a resident moves forward in their recovery process, services are decreased, and independence and autonomy are established prior to discharge. The program gives residents the opportunity to prepare for living independently in recovery while being in a safe, therapeutic environment. Staff are available to offer support, guidance, and resources to help residents with the challenges of sustaining life-long change.

The SeaView Community Services Recovery Housing Program offers substance use disorder treatment in a structured setting, utilizing traditional and evidence-based therapies. Our clinical team is dedicated to helping their clients find new ways of coping, thinking, and living, all to overcome the challenges of addiction.
